Mathlotha

A celebratory dish from Saudi Arabia, Mathlotha is a layered masterpiece featuring jareesh (cracked wheat porridge), qursan (thin flatbread), and seasoned rice, all topped with tender chunks of meat. It embodies Saudi hospitality and is often served at special occasions.

๐Ÿง‚ Ingredients

  • 1 kg Lamb or Chicken(cut into large chunks)
  • 1.5 cups Cracked wheat (Jareesh)
  • 1.5 cups Basmati rice(soaked for 30 minutes)
  • 2 cups Whole wheat flour(for qursan)
  • 2 large Onions(1 chopped, 1 sliced)
  • 4 cloves Garlic(minced)
  • 3 medium Tomatoes(pureed)
  • 6 cups Chicken or Lamb broth(for jareesh and rice)
  • 1 tbsp Spices (cardamom, cinnamon, cloves, black pepper)(mixed)
  • to taste Salt
  • 4 tbsp Ghee or Butter
  • as needed Water

๐Ÿ’ก Pro Tips

  • โœ“Ensure the meat is cooked until very tender for the best texture.
  • โœ“The qursan should be thin enough to absorb the flavors of the broth.
  • โœ“Adjust the consistency of the jareesh to your preference; some like it thicker, others thinner.
